在电子表格处理软件中,详细筛选是一项核心的数据管理功能,它允许用户根据特定条件,从庞杂的数据集合中精准提取所需信息。这项功能超越了基础的筛选操作,通过组合多重规则、应用复杂逻辑以及利用高级条件设置,实现对数据的深度挖掘与精细化处理。其核心价值在于提升数据处理的效率与准确性,帮助用户快速聚焦关键数据点,为后续的分析与决策提供清晰、可靠的数据基础。
功能定位与核心目标 详细筛选的主要目标是解决简单筛选无法应对的多条件、高精度数据查询需求。它并非简单地隐藏不符合单一条件的数据行,而是构建一个灵活的查询框架,用户可以在此框架内设定精确的匹配值、数值区间、文本模式或日期范围,甚至将不同字段的条件通过“与”、“或”逻辑进行关联,从而形成一张严密的过滤网,只让完全符合所有预设规则的数据呈现出来。 实现方式与典型场景 实现详细筛选通常依赖于软件内置的“高级筛选”或类似功能模块。用户需要在一个独立区域清晰定义筛选条件,其中包含数据表的列标题以及其下对应的具体条件值。典型应用场景极为广泛,例如在销售报表中同时筛选出特定地区、特定产品类别且销售额高于某一阈值的记录;在人事信息表中查找满足多项学历与工作经验要求的候选人;或是在库存清单中定位那些库存量低于安全线且已超过特定保质期的商品条目。 操作要点与效果呈现 成功进行详细筛选的关键在于条件区域的正确构建。条件必须严格按照原数据表的列结构进行排列,同一行内的条件默认为“与”关系,即需同时满足;不同行之间的条件则构成“或”关系,即满足任一行即可。执行筛选后,原数据区域将只显示完全匹配条件的数据行,其余数据被暂时隐藏,从而形成一个高度定制化的数据视图。这种处理方式极大地优化了在大量数据中寻找规律、排查问题或准备特定数据子集的工作流程。在数据处理领域,掌握详细筛选的技巧等同于拥有了一把精准解剖数据的手术刀。它使我们能够超越表面浏览,深入数据肌理,依据多维、复杂的规则提取出极具价值的信息切片。以下将从多个维度系统阐述详细筛选的机制、方法与策略。
一、 详细筛选的核心机制与条件构建逻辑 详细筛选功能的底层逻辑是基于用户自定义的条件集合,对数据列表进行逐行逻辑判定。其核心在于“条件区域”的建立。这个区域是一个独立于源数据表的工作表范围,用户需要在此处复刻源数据的列标题,并在对应标题下方输入筛选条件。条件的表达方式非常灵活:可以是精确的文本或数字,例如在“部门”列下输入“市场部”;可以是使用比较运算符(如>、<、>=、<=、<>)的表达式,例如在“销售额”列下输入“>10000”;也可以是带有通配符的文本模式,例如在“姓名”列下输入“张”,用于查找所有张姓人员。 更关键的是逻辑关系的组织。在同一行内,不同列下设置的条件构成“与”关系,这意味着目标数据行必须同时满足该行所有列的条件。例如,一行中设置了“部门:市场部”和“销售额>10000”,则只会筛选出市场部中销售额过万的数据。而将不同条件组放置于不同的行,则构成了“或”关系,数据行只要满足其中任意一行的所有条件,就会被筛选出来。例如,第一行设置“部门:市场部”,第二行设置“部门:技术部”,则会筛选出所有属于市场部或技术部的数据。 二、 实施详细筛选的完整操作流程 首先,需要在工作表的一个空白区域构建条件区域。务必确保条件区域的列标题与源数据区域的列标题完全一致,这是正确匹配的基础。接着,在对应标题下方输入具体的筛选条件。然后,选中源数据区域中的任意单元格,找到并启动“高级筛选”功能对话框。在对话框中,需要正确指定“列表区域”(即源数据范围)和“条件区域”(即刚构建的条件范围)。此外,还需选择筛选结果的呈现方式:可以选择“在原有区域显示筛选结果”,这样会直接在原数据表隐藏不符合条件的行;也可以选择“将筛选结果复制到其他位置”,并在“复制到”框中指定一个起始单元格,这样会将符合条件的数据行复制到一个新的区域,而不影响原数据。最后,点击确定,系统便会根据设定的逻辑执行筛选。 三、 应对复杂场景的高级筛选策略 面对更加复杂的数据查询需求,可以组合运用多种策略。一是利用计算条件。当筛选条件并非直接来源于数据表现有字段,而是需要经过计算得出时,可以在条件区域使用公式。例如,需要筛选出“利润”(利润可能由销售额和成本计算得出)高于平均值的记录,可以在条件区域创建一个标题(如“高利润判定”),并在其下输入一个引用源数据相关单元格进行计算的公式,该公式结果应为逻辑值真或假。二是处理多表关联筛选。虽然单个高级筛选功能通常作用于一个数据列表,但通过巧妙构建条件区域,可以间接实现基于多个关联字段的复杂查询,例如结合产品编号和客户编号来筛选特定的交易记录。三是进行数据去重提取。高级筛选功能通常自带“选择不重复的记录”选项,当与条件筛选结合时,可以在筛选出特定数据子集的同时,去除该子集中完全重复的行,直接得到唯一值列表,这在整理客户名单或产品目录时非常实用。 四、 常见问题排查与实用技巧锦囊 在实际操作中,可能会遇到筛选结果不符合预期的情况。最常见的原因是条件区域构建错误,例如列标题有空格或字符与原数据不一致,或者条件之间的逻辑关系(同行“与”、异行“或”)设置错误。另一个常见问题是当源数据新增或修改后,筛选结果不会自动更新,需要重新执行一次高级筛选操作。为了提高效率,可以将常用的复杂条件区域定义名称,方便以后快速调用。对于需要频繁变动的条件,甚至可以将条件单元格与工作表上的控件(如下拉列表)链接,实现动态交互式筛选。此外,在执行“复制到其他位置”的筛选时,务必确保目标区域有足够的空白空间,以免覆盖现有数据。 五、 详细筛选在数据分析工作流中的角色 详细筛选绝非一个孤立的功能,它是数据预处理和分析链条上的关键一环。在数据清洗阶段,它可以快速定位并隔离出异常值、错误数据或待修正的记录。在数据探索阶段,它帮助分析师快速创建不同的数据分组和子集,以便进行对比分析和趋势观察。在报告生成阶段,它是提取特定维度数据、制作定制化报表的高效工具。通过熟练掌握详细筛选,用户能够显著减少在庞杂数据中手动查找和筛选的时间,将更多精力投入到真正的数据洞察和业务决策中去,从而最大化数据的潜在价值。
107人看过